projects
/
firefly-linux-kernel-4.4.55.git
/ commitd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
| commitdiff |
tree
raw
|
patch
| inline |
side by side
(parent:
70c481f
)
m701 - tp: change the order that ft5306 sleep after set reg.
author
zhengxing
<zhengxing@rock-chips.com>
Mon, 15 Oct 2012 05:11:23 +0000
(13:11 +0800)
committer
zhengxing
<zhengxing@rock-chips.com>
Mon, 15 Oct 2012 05:12:09 +0000
(13:12 +0800)
drivers/input/touchscreen/ft5306_ts_av.c
patch
|
blob
|
history
diff --git
a/drivers/input/touchscreen/ft5306_ts_av.c
b/drivers/input/touchscreen/ft5306_ts_av.c
index e6a1795f97c89e55e4da3bd7422058244c78eba2..bfa38cab6ff6229d0db59354ed1548fbf6556249 100644
(file)
--- a/
drivers/input/touchscreen/ft5306_ts_av.c
+++ b/
drivers/input/touchscreen/ft5306_ts_av.c
@@
-707,12
+707,16
@@
static void ft5306_suspend(struct early_suspend *h)
int err;
\r
ft5x0x_ts = container_of(h, struct ft5x0x_ts_data, ft5306_early_suspend);
\r
FTprintk("TSP ft5306_suspend\n");
\r
+ err = ft5306_set_regs(this_client, 0xA5, buf_w, 1);
\r
+ if (err > 0)
\r
+ printk("ft5306_set_regs OK!!\n");
\r
+
\r
+ msleep(20);
\r
+
\r
if (ft5x0x_ts->platform_sleep){
\r
ft5x0x_ts->platform_sleep();
\r
}
\r
- err = ft5306_set_regs(this_client,0xA5,buf_w,1);
\r
- if (err>0)
\r
- printk("ft5306_set_regs OK!!\n");
\r
+
\r
disable_irq(ft5x0x_ts->irq);
\r
}
\r
\r